temp-tables

在 Oracle SQL 中创建全局临时表

我是 SQL 新手。我想在 Oracle SQL 中创建一个(全局或非全局)临时表,其中将包含SELECT * FROM tbl_NAME WHERE... 形式的简单数据选择,并且在我的会话结束后将被删除(就像 MSFT SQL 临时表一样形成##tbl_NAME)。 我在网上发现一种方法是: CREATE GLOBAL TEMPORARY TABLE tmp_table SELECT * ... »

如何在 MySQL 中创建临时表以将表数据输出为 CSV 文件?

我有一个用于从数据库表创建 CSV 文件的脚本,它工作正常,除了它输出表中的所有数据,而且我需要它只为当前登录的用户输出数据。我正在开发的应用程序是让用户能够存储他们已经阅读、想要阅读等的书籍列表,并且我希望能够允许他们下载他们可以导入 Excel 的书籍列表例如。 (考虑到还有 OpenOffice 等以及 MS Excel,CSV 文件会是最好的选择吗?) 我发现我需要创建一个临时表来使用选... »

php

C++:Switch 语句与查找表的性能

我尝试比较switch 语句和查找表的性能,如下所示。 这是使用switch语句的代码 #include <stdio.h> int main() { int n = 3; for (long i = 0; i < 10000000; ++i) { switch (n) { case 0: pri... »

c++

HTML/CSS:表格文本对齐

我有这个: http://jsfiddle.net/bDTRz/ 无论内容如何,​​我都希望它看起来都一样(我想我需要宽度,但我不知道在哪里)。我在所有桌子上都做了 width: 100%。 因为如果您看到“Idag”,您会看到文本与“旧”有何不同。这是因为“old”列中的 td 比“idag”中的 td 长(日期+时间)(仅时间)。 我该如何解决这个问题?我知道我需要在 td 上使用宽度,... »

如何设置 CSS 表格的最大高度?

我正在尝试使用本文中概述的方法将 div 中的文本垂直居中:http://css-tricks.com/vertically-center-multi-lined-text/ .container { width: 160px; margin: 80px auto; padding: 5px; height: 60px; max-hei... »

css

在没有单独的 CREATE TABLE 的 SELECT 语句中创建临时表

是否可以在不使用 create table 语句并指定每个列类型的情况下从 select 语句创建临时(仅限会话)表?我知道派生表可以做到这一点,但那些是超级临时的(仅限语句),我想重复使用。 如果我不必编写创建表命令并保持列列表和类型列表匹配,这将节省时间。... »

PHP:删除不在大列表中的行

如果表中的值不是在通过 XML API 传入的非常大的集合(20,000 项)中,我的应用程序需要更改表中的值。显然,很容易创建一个非常慢的解决方案。 我想知道您会如何建议这样做?我正在考虑将 XML 中项目的唯一 ID 添加到临时表中,然后执行单个查询: UPDATE item SET status = "deleted" WHERE id NOT IN (SELECT id FROM ke... »

php

从 Access 前端链接到新的 SQL Server 表

我使用 Access 作为 SQL Server 的前端。我能够链接表格没问题。当我意识到我的数据库中需要一个新表时,我正在愉快地开发我的用户界面。我创建了它并在 SQL Server 中填充了它。现在我想将该表链接到我的 Access 前端。我在 Access 中找不到明显的方法来链接到新创建的表。有没有办法做到这一点,如何在不必重新开始新的 ODBC 连接的情况下做到这一点?谢谢。 我正在使用... »

使用 jdbc 插入多个表

我正在尝试使用 JDBC 插入多个表。因为它必须要快,所以我想使用PreparedStatement 和executeBatch 方法。表由外键关系组合。 第一个想法是使用getGeneratedKeys(),但某些 JDBC 驱动程序会失败。例如。 PostgreSQL。 第二个想法是使用 SQL-currval(...) 函数。但是必须为一个语句调用执行批处理,而另一个语句使所有键都具有相... »

SQL Server 中派生表的范围

我最近一直在研究 SQL 并进行了一些探索。关于临时表,我发现了 3 种不同的临时表类型: 1) 创建表#TempTable 2) 声明表@TempTable 3) SELECT * FROM (SELECT * FROM Customers) AS TempTable 现在我了解了 #TempTable 和 @TempTable 类型背后的范围,但是示例 3 中的派生表呢?这个派生表存储... »

带有审计表的数据更改历史记录:分组更改

假设我想将用户和组存储在 MySQL 数据库中。他们有一个关系n:m。为了跟踪所有更改,每个表都有一个审计表 user_journal、group_journal 和 user_group_journal。 MySQL 触发器在每次 INSERT 或 UPDATE 时将当前记录复制到日志表(不支持 DELETES,因为我需要应用程序用户删除记录的信息——所以有一个标志 active 将设置为 @ ... »

我想制作删除临时文件的 .bat 文件(开始最小化并自动关闭)

我想出了以下代码,它开始最小化,等待 5 秒(对于慢速 PC)后删除临时文件并应自动关闭,但由于某种原因,自动关闭不起作用,.bat 文件保持最小化。< /p> 我尝试使用 exit 命令,但它的效果为 0,因为 goto :EOF 阻止它执行,但如果我将删除 goto :EOF 脚本不会删除临时文件 if not DEFINED IS_MINIMIZED set IS_MINIMIZED=1... »

无法理解配置单元中外部关键字的意义

我有几个疑问需要澄清: 如果我创建的表没有使用“External”关键字,但指定了“位置”,那么它是 Hive 中的外部表还是内部表? 如果我在表名中使用“external”关键字但未指定“位置”,它将被保存到默认存储的配置单元/仓库位置。在这种情况下,它会是一个外部表吗? 总的来说,我想了解是什么使表格成为外部的,关键字“外部”或指定“位置”。 任何帮助将不胜感激。 ... »

我的 php 表在 IE 中显示正常,但在 Chrome 中显示不正常

我尝试更改 CSS 以使背景变黑,但这没有奏效。我还通过谷歌搜索了任何解决方案,但没有找到任何解决方案。网页以非常暗(几乎是黑色)的背景图像显示,表格的文本和边框为白色。它们在 IE 中显示良好,但在 Chrome 中它们具有浅蓝色背景,并且文本几乎不可见。任何关于如何解决这个问题的想法都将非常感激。 CSS 是: div.vpolls .vpdt { margin:.4em 10% .4... »

css

具有多个位置列的 FusionTablesLayer

所以我有一个 FusionTablesLayer,其中多个位置列都设置为 KML 值。您可以在双击该行后选择“预览KML”来查看坐标。我合成了一张图片来显示预期结果的各个列(按比例缩放)。 第一列Islands 用红色表示,West 用绿色表示,East 用蓝色表示。 尝试在 JSFiddle 中使用它根本不起作用。每个图层在切换到时都使用 same 列。预期结果是单击 West 时向西显示... »

Greenplum - 外部表

我有一组位于服务器位置的制表符分隔文件,并且我创建了一个元数据表和一个外部表,其布局与元数据表相同。 我想知道当我在 PgAdmin 3 中运行外部表脚本时,它是否应该使用服务器位置上的文件(制表符分隔的文件)中的数据加载外部表? 我想应该是这样,但是当我对 ext 表运行 SELECT 查询时,它会抛出一个错误: (ERROR: http response code 404 from ... »